词源 | million-footed Manhattan. A phrase used by Walt Whitman in his poem “A Broadway Pageant” (1883). In it he also called the borough “Superb-faced Manhattan.” It might more accu- rately be called twenty-million footed Manhattan today, count- ing visitors. |
